We are an independent specialist tax practice advising on complex UK tax matters, including HMRC enquiries, investigations, disclosures and high-level advisory work whilst offering a collaborative, supportive environment where professionals develop deep expertise rather than broad, generalist experience. Our client base is diverse and includes high-net-worth individuals, trusts, family offices, owner‑managed businesses, and large corporate businesses.
About the RoleWe are seeking a Manager or Senior Manager with strong UK personal tax and offshore trust expertise to join our fully remote team. The role centres on advising non-UK resident trustees on the UK tax implications of offshore trust structures, including residence, domicile, CGT and IHT matters. This is primarily a private client advisory role with exposure to tax enquiries and disclosures where relevant.
You will work closely with Directors to deliver high-quality technical advice, manage HNW client and trustee relationships, and support the efficient delivery of complex trust engagements.
